https://dailytrust.com/stop-subsidy-payment-increase-petrol-price-to-n750-litre-world-bank-tells-fg/



Daily Trust had reported in September that despite the numerous assurances by President Bola Ahmed Tinubu that the petrol subsidy regime was gone, the government paid N169.4 billion as subsidy in August to keep the pump price at N620 per litre.



The World Bank’s lead economist for Nigeria, Alex Sienaert, confirmed the continuous payment of petrol subsidy by the government in Abuja yesterday during his presentation of the Nigeria Development Update (NDU), December 2023 Edition.
